Landscaping installation projects typically fall within a range of costs depending on scope and complexity. Basic projects tend to be more affordable, while extensive designs may require a higher investment.

$1,500 - $5,000 for smaller or simpler installations

$5,000 - $15,000 for more comprehensive landscape designs

Project Type Typical Range
Garden Bed Installation $1,500 - $4,000
Patio or Walkway $3,000 - $8,000
Lawn Installation $2,000 - $6,000
Retaining Wall $4,000 - $12,000
Landscape Design & Planting $2,500 - $7,000
Water Features $5,000 - $15,000
Complete Landscape Renovation $10,000 - $25,000

What affects the cost

Understanding the factors that influence landscaping installation costs can help in planning and budgeting for a project. Several elements can impact the overall expenses involved.

  • Materials: The choice of materials, such as pavers, stones, or planting supplies, can significantly affect costs.
  • Size and Scope: Larger or more extensive projects typically require more resources and labor, influencing the overall price.
  • Labor Complexity: The difficulty of installation, including terrain or design intricacies, can impact labor requirements and costs.
  • Permitting: Obtaining necessary permits or approvals may add to the project expenses and timeline.
  • Extras: Additional features like lighting, irrigation, or decorative elements can increase the total cost.
Scope/Size Typical Range
Small garden bed or border $500 - $2,000
Medium backyard (up to 1/4 acre) $2,000 - $8,000
Large yard or multiple areas $8,000 - $20,000
Extensive landscaping or large-scale projects $20,000 - $50,000+

This table provides a general overview of typical costs associated with landscaping installation projects of varying scopes.
